Once the stone is heated, place your seasoned steaks onto the scorching surface. You should hear an immediate sizzle! Now, let the magic happen. For medium-rare (130-135°F or 54-57°C internal temperature), sear each side for about 2-4 minutes, depending on the thickness of the steak. Remember, the cooking time will vary depending on the thickness of the steak and how hot your stone is.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ature, which is the most accurate way to gauge doneness. For medium (135-145°F or 57-63°C), cook for about 3-5 minutes per side. For medium-well (145-155°F or 63-68°C), cook for 4-6 minutes per side. And for well-done (160°F or 71°C and above), cook for 5-7 minutes per side.
